Sujet Pêche Mot clé Législation de base Aquaculture Mariculture Institution Politique/planification Participation du public EIA Aire géographique Asie et Pacifique, Australie et Nouvelle-Zélande, Océan Indien, Océanie, Pacifique Sud Résumé The purpose of this Act, consisting of 146 sections divided into five Parts and completed by five Schedules, is to achieve well-planned sustainable development of marine farming activities having regard to the need to (a) integrate marine farming activities with other marine uses; (b) minimize any adverse impact of marine farming activities; (c) set aside areas for activities other than for marine farming activities; (d) take account of land uses; and (e) take account of the community's right to have an interest in those activities. A Marine Farming Planning Review Panel is established to consider draft plans, draft amendments to marine farming development plans and draft modifications to marine farming development plans, and to consider environmental impact statements.
